### Rounding drift in currency conversion

If a customer reports totals that are off by a cent or two, it's almost always the Fernwald converter rounding per line item instead of per invoice. Don't hand-correct amounts — run the `reconcile-rounding` job, which recomputes totals and writes adjustments to the ledger table. The job prompts for the billing database; use the connection string provided below.

warehouse DSN: mssql://rusdor_svc:0FSWCn9@db-951a.paliqforge.local:5432/ulawyn

Handover — Ottervale Firmware Update Channel

Taking over from me: the Ottervale delta-update channel pushes signed firmware to Brindlecote sensor units nightly at 02:00. The staging ring (about 40 devices) promotes to production after 48 clean hours. Watch the Skeinwatch dashboard for rollback storms — more than three in an hour means the manifest signer is misbehaving. Review pending channel changes in the Copperden queue before approving. If the signing enclave ever locks out, recover it with the passphrase below.

recovery phrase for bawef-haduf: wenax-druox-julmir

Subject: Currency hedging — where we landed

Team,

Quick update for branch managers. After the swings in the kronar last month, we've decided to hedge roughly seventy percent of projected receivables for the Almere and Westfold branches through the next two quarters. Treasury ran the numbers and the cost is manageable versus the downside we'd otherwise carry. Nothing changes in your day-to-day pricing for now — quote as usual and let head office absorb the movement. The reasoning links to the confidential plan summarised below.

— Petra

management briefing: Jorixax Holdings is in early talks to buy Casixax Holdings for about $420.3 million. The Fenmir launch date is October 27, and nothing goes to the press before then. Legal wants the Keloxek Foods term sheet redrafted before April 16.

### Gallerypath Audio Guide v2.8.1

- Tour audio now served over signed, time-limited links.
- Removed legacy plaintext session tokens from local storage.
- Offline cache encrypted at rest; key derived per device.
- Patched path traversal in exhibit bundle loader.
- Added audit logging for curator uploads.

Security review requested before the Hollowmere museum rollout. All findings and questions route to the engineer named directly below.

account owner for bawip-tahag: Raleth Quenok